How does this neonatal sensor compare to other disposable sensors in terms of accuracy and sensitivity?
This Masimo SET LNCS Neonatal Disposable Sensor is designed for high accuracy and sensitivity, commonly used in clinical settings to monitor neonatal patients effectively. [Manufacturer Info]
What specific clinical scenarios are ideal for using the Masimo SET LNCS Neonatal Disposable Sensor?
Ideal clinical scenarios for this sensor include continuous monitoring of neonates in intensive care units, where accurate and reliable readings are crucial for patient care. [Manufacturer Info]
Are there any special considerations when applying this sensor to neonatal patients?
Special considerations include ensuring the sensor is securely attached and positioned correctly to avoid any disruption in monitoring and to minimize discomfort for the neonatal patient. [Manufacturer Info]
How often should the sensor be checked or replaced during prolonged patient monitoring?
The sensor should be checked regularly for proper function and adherence, and typically replaced every 24 hours to ensure continuous accuracy and to prevent skin irritation. [Manufacturer Info]
Can this sensor be used with devices from manufacturers other than Physio Control, and if yes, are there any limitations?
This sensor is primarily designed for compatibility with Physio Control devices; using it with other manufacturers' devices is not recommended without verifying compatibility. [Manufacturer Info]
What are the common troubleshooting steps if the sensor's readings seem inconsistent?
Common troubleshooting steps include checking the sensor's placement, ensuring it's properly connected to the monitoring device, and replacing the sensor if issues persist. [Manufacturer Info]
Is there any risk of skin irritation or allergic reactions in neonates using this disposable sensor?
As a disposable sensor, it is generally designed to minimize skin irritation and allergic reactions, but monitoring for any signs of discomfort or adverse reactions in neonates is recommended. [Product Specs]
How does the cost of this sensor per box compare with other neonatal sensors on the market?
Cost comparisons depend on various factors, but disposable sensors like this one are typically priced competitively to meet the needs of healthcare facilities while ensuring quality and reliability. [Manufacturer Info]
Are there specific storage conditions required for maintaining the integrity of these sensors before use?
These sensors should be stored in a dry, cool environment away from direct sunlight to maintain their integrity until use. [Product Specs]
